2013-02-20 46 views
0

我想弄清楚如何将服务器目录中的最新文件复制到c#中的本地目录。将服务器上的最新文件复制到本地目录

我需要这样做超过100个目录。他们将全部复制并重命名为相同的本地目录。

所有命名的目录:例如\ ServerPath \ 01,\ ServerPath \ 02,\ ServerPath \ 03等

现在我有一个批处理脚本,它会执行它,但它需要永久,因为它通过每个目录中的每个文件。

回答

0

我的直接想法是“Robocopy可能吗?”我在Google上搜索了一个“Robocopy最新文件”,并提出了一个blog post关于使用powershell脚本处理这个问题。

这应该至少为您提供最新的文件,而无需通过“...每个目录中的每个文件”。

+0

太棒了,非常感谢。这要快得多。唯一的问题是该主目录中还有其他的子目录,我不想从中获取。但是这个脚本是一个很好的开始。 – user2089341 2013-02-20 22:22:29

+0

没有probs。我在过去一年左右才开始使用Robocopy,但我认为它是一个很好的工具。 PowerShell脚本是我偶然发现的其他东西,但我很高兴它有一些用处。 – 2013-02-21 01:59:12

相关问题